Transaction cc99983d7221815e50af8d139a5c4acbf9839785ef2ba9a240b7f94202f79e31
4 Input
2 Outputs
- cc99983d7221815e50af8d139a5c4acbf9839785ef2ba9a240b7f94202f79e31:0
- cc99983d7221815e50af8d139a5c4acbf9839785ef2ba9a240b7f94202f79e31:1
value 1802783
address mofFTgvWSbP3HANraJcp9nZx2mXoDjB5DP
value 24184492
address mzAs1AGf1Po5kQX1ZDQ1xJnotXwLi8XqEX